Area = (theta/360)* pi * r^2 
where theta is the angle of  the sector 
subs by your givens in the above equation 
2.512 = (theta/360) * pi * (4)^2 
theta = (2.512 * 360) /(pi*(4)^2)
theta = 18 degree 
        
             
        
        
        
Answer:
10 feets 
Step-by-step explanation:
Given that:
Road sign shadow (Rs) = 4 feets
Height of man (Hm) = 6
Man shadow (Ms) = 2.4 feets
Height of road sign (Hr) = x
Height of road sign / shadow of road sign = height of man / shadow of man
Hr/Rs = Hm / Ms
x / 4 = 6 / 2.4
Cross multiply :
4*6 = 2.4*x
24 = 2.4x
x = 24 / 2.4
x = 10 feets
Hence, height of road sign = 10 feets
